December Visa Bulletin Update: USCIS to Honor Filing Dates for EB-1 through EB-4, Final Action Dates for EB-5

Next month, USCIS will accept employment-based first through fourth preference adjustment of status applications from foreign nationals with a priority date that is current for filing under the State Department’s December Visa Bulletin. USCIS will accept employment-based fifth preference category (both regional center and non-regional center based) adjustment of status applications from foreign nationals with a priority date that is current for final action.
Employment-Based Priority Date Cut-offs for December 2016
To be eligible to file an employment-based adjustment application in December, employer-sponsored foreign nationals must have a priority date that is earlier than the date listed below for their preference category and country.
EB-1
Current for all countries.
EB-2
China: March 1, 2013
India: April 22, 2009
All other countries: Current
EB-3 Professionals and Skilled Workers
China: May 1, 2014
India: July 1, 2005
Philippines: September 1, 2013
All other countries: Current
EB-3 Other Workers
China: August 1, 2009
India: July 1, 2005
Philippines: September 1, 2013
All other countries: Current
EB-5 Non-Regional Center
China: March 22, 2014
All other countries: Current
EB-5 Regional Center
China: March 22, 2014
All other countries: Current
